Descrition of 1310nm 1550nm Single Mode MEMS Variable Optical Attenuator
MEMS VOA (Micro Electro-Mechanical Systems Variable Optical Attenuator) is a micro-optic component designed for next generation, dynamically configurable optical networks. It is based on the Photonic Integrated Circuit (PIC) and electrostatic MEMS technology. The reflective mirror MEMS technology enables the creation of products with high attenuation levels and can be configured as bright or dark devices. When combined with the advanced packaging and manufacturing capabilities, this results in a new category of MEMS components that are designed to exceed specifications for performance, compactness, manufacturability and reliability. Operating wavelength, attenuation type, drive voltage, fiber type, fiber length and connectors can be customized.

Application
Power control and equalization in multi channel System
Gain-tilt control in EDFAS
Receiver protection
Channel on/off switching
